Rob,

this is an incremental update to my pthread patches. It will fix a problem
when a thread is joined before the creation completed.

BTW, i have not added any locks yet (the actual implementation had no),
but IMHO they are required in the exit,join,cancel code. I will add locks
if you agree.

Greetings,
Thomas

2002-04-24  Thomas Pfaff  <[EMAIL PROTECTED]>

        * thread.cc (thread_init_wrapper): Check if thread is alreay
        joined
        (__pthread_join): Set joiner first.
        (__pthread_detach): Ditto.


Attachment: pthread_join.patch
Description: Binary data

Reply via email to